Autor | Zpráva | ||
---|---|---|---|
petříček Profil * |
#1 · Zasláno: 8. 2. 2008, 15:48:52
Ahoj...
ačkoli jsem toho přečetl hodně, nevím, proč se mi box neroztahuje vždy až dolů, napříč prohližeči. děkuji všem za odpovědi html { height: 100%; font-size: 62.5%; } body { height: 100%; text-align: center; font: 1.2em Verdana, Arial, Helvetica, sans-serif; background: #fff url('../img/pozadi.gif') repeat-x 0 0; } #main { width: 100%; min-height: 100%; height: 100%; position: relative; } body>#main { height: auto; } #obsah { background: red ; min-height: 650px; height: 100%; } #obsah-box { width: 770px; margin: 0 auto; background-color: #fff; border-right: 1px solid #B0B0B0; border-left: 1px solid #B0B0B0; text-align: left; padding-bottom: 100px; height: 100%; } #footer { width: 100%; height: 60px; background-color: #003A67; position: absolute; overflow: hidden; bottom: 0; left: 0; } <body> <div id="main"> <div id="obsah"> <div id="obsah-box"> <p>xkjckzxjckjckzjckzjxc</p> </div> </div> <div id="footer">kjhdsajahdjkashd</div> </div> </body> Když odzoomuju v Opeře (zmenším), tak se mi ten obsah neroztáhne na celou výšku okna... |
||
svetříček Profil * |
#2 · Zasláno: 9. 2. 2008, 13:47:38
Opravdu nikdo neví?
Vím, že asi naléhám, ale potřeboval bych, aby se mi #obsah s červeným pozadím roztahoval až dolů, což nedělá a já nevím proč. |
||
kletely Profil |
#3 · Zasláno: 9. 2. 2008, 14:05:25
petříček
lebo dlžka sa natiahne podla dlžky textu... ...ale skús spraviť overflow: auto; možno to pôjde |
||
svetříček Profil * |
#4 · Zasláno: 9. 2. 2008, 16:39:57
no právě jsem chtěl, aby se to vždy roztáhlo přes celou výšku okna, nevím proč nefunguje height: 100%, když mám definovanou výšku pro body i html
overflow: auto; to s tím moc nesouvisí... |
||
xlx21 Profil |
#5 · Zasláno: 10. 2. 2008, 11:35:23
pouzivaj jednotky em nie px
|
||
mantisa Profil |
#6 · Zasláno: 10. 2. 2008, 15:30:28
xlx21
a proč by? jak to souvisí s tím problémem nj, klasický úkaz této diskuse PARDON za OT |
||
svetříček Profil * |
#7 · Zasláno: 10. 2. 2008, 16:16:27
Mám tedy někde chybu, prosímvás; i když mám 100% výšku?
Nechápu, proč se mi to nenatáhne??? |
||
yFang Profil |
#8 · Zasláno: 10. 2. 2008, 16:39:21
svetříček
Height 100% funguje jen v IE. Zkus min-height:100%, ale neručím za to jestli to bude fungovat. :) |
||
mantisa Profil |
#9 · Zasláno: 10. 2. 2008, 17:06:45
yFang
neřekl bych, že to moc pomůže, blíže jsem to nezkoumal, ale zřejmě požaduješ, aby se ta červená roztáhla až dolů... no, co takhle dát background-color: red tomu divu #main? myslím, že by to mělo stačit proč nefunguje 100% výška u vnořeného divu do divu #main momentálně nevím, také by mě to zajímalo... |
||
mantisa Profil |
#10 · Zasláno: 12. 2. 2008, 15:04:51
EDIT:
Ahoj, docela by mě zajímalo, proč nefunguj v tomto případě 100% výška vnořeného divu, když vnější má nastaveno 100% a html i body také... Budu to totiž za nedlouho řešit a rád bych si ušetřil pár chvilek. Děkuji. |
||
Manq Profil |
#11 · Zasláno: 12. 2. 2008, 15:27:25
mantisa
nj, klasický úkaz této diskuse Proč viníš hned celou diskusi? Kvůli jednomu xlx21 to snad není nutné, nemyslíš? proč nefunguje 100% výška u vnořeného divu do divu #main momentálně nevím, také by mě to zajímalo... Ale ona funguje. Tento konkrétní případ jsem nezkoušel. |
||
Grifin Profil * |
#12 · Zasláno: 12. 2. 2008, 16:25:29
Procentni vyjadreni velikosti funguje pouze za predpokladu ze rodicovsky element zna svou velikosti (vysku) na to se da pouzit javascript zjisti ti velikost otevreneho okna a tu pak zapise do kodu.
|
||
mantisa Profil |
#13 · Zasláno: 12. 2. 2008, 16:51:49
to je moc složité, uvedené ukázka by měla taky šlapat, a já jsem nervozní, že na to zatím nemohu přijít
|
||
Neoas Profil * |
#14 · Zasláno: 13. 2. 2008, 19:15:23
Taky to resim uz pomerne dlouho a nenapada me jak to mam udelat :(
|
||
Časová prodleva: 16 let
|
0